What does 'feels like' temperature mean?
Feels-like (apparent) temperature accounts for humidity, wind chill and direct sunshine — variables that change how the human body perceives heat or cold. On hot, humid days it can be 3-7°C above the actual reading; on cold windy days it can be 5-15°C below.
Why does the temperature in Bānda differ from nearby cities?
Even short distances can change temperatures noticeably. Bānda's reading reflects altitude, proximity to large bodies of water, urban heat island effects, and the exact location of the monitoring stations supplying the data. Coastal cities are typically milder and more humid than inland equivalents.
